Executive Certificate in Strategic Management

                                


Whether you provide a finished product to your customer, or you provide services, in this economy thinking strategically is critical for survival. The businesses that survive today not only understand the impact of inventory movements, capacity issues, data analysis and quality, they actively lead their organizations in directions that allow them to excel above the competition.



What You'll Learn

  • Gain an understanding of what it takes to put your company first in the marketplace.
  • Be able to identify those metrics that drive your costs and expenses and know how to control them.
  • Increase your profit margin by increasing efficiencies and eliminating inefficiencies.
  • Identify and Increase the value added in your product or service, driving greater sales.
  • Take a greater share of the market by your ability to respond to demand changes in a timely fashion.
  • Strengthen your abilities to Direct, Produce, Negotiate and Lead.


To complete the Executive Certificate, complete any EIGHT of the following sessions:
